class TestSessions(IntegrationTestCase):
"""
Tests that server cleans up stale connections after session timeout and client times out too.
"""
LEDGER = lbry.wallet
async def test_session_bloat_from_socket_timeout(self):
await self.conductor.stop_spv()
await self.ledger.stop()
self.conductor.spv_node.session_timeout = 1
await self.conductor.start_spv()
session = ClientSession(
network=None, server=(self.conductor.spv_node.hostname, self.conductor.spv_node.port), timeout=0.2
)
await session.create_connection()
await session.send_request('server.banner', ())
self.assertEqual(len(self.conductor.spv_node.server.session_mgr.sessions), 1)
self.assertFalse(session.is_closing())
await asyncio.sleep(1.1)
with self.assertRaises(asyncio.TimeoutError):
await session.send_request('server.banner', ())
self.assertTrue(session.is_closing())
self.assertEqual(len(self.conductor.spv_node.server.session_mgr.sessions), 0)

class TestUsagePayment(CommandTestCase):
async def test_single_server_payment(self):
self.manager.usage_payment_service.payment_period = 1
await self.manager.usage_payment_service.stop()
await self.manager.usage_payment_service.start(self.ledger, self.wallet)
address = (await self.account.receiving.get_addresses(limit=1, only_usable=True))[0]
_, history = await self.ledger.get_local_status_and_history(address)
self.assertEqual(history, [])
node = SPVNode(self.conductor.spv_module, node_number=2)
await node.start(self.blockchain, extraconf={"PAYMENT_ADDRESS": address, "DAILY_FEE": "1.1"})
self.daemon.jsonrpc_settings_set('lbryum_servers', [f"{node.hostname}:{node.port}"])
with self.assertLogs(level='WARNING') as cm:
await self.daemon.jsonrpc_wallet_reconnect()
features = await self.ledger.network.get_server_features()
self.assertEqual(features["payment_address"], address)
self.assertEqual(features["daily_fee"], "1.1")
elapsed = 0
while not cm.output:
await asyncio.sleep(0.1)
elapsed += 1
if elapsed > 30:
raise TimeoutError('Nothing logged for 3 seconds.')
self.assertEqual(
cm.output,
['WARNING:lbry.wallet.usage_payment:Server asked 1.1 LBC as daily fee, but '
'maximum allowed is 1.0 LBC. Skipping payment round.']
)
await node.stop(False)
await node.start(self.blockchain, extraconf={"PAYMENT_ADDRESS": address, "DAILY_FEE": "1.0"})
self.addCleanup(node.stop)
self.daemon.jsonrpc_settings_set('lbryum_servers', [f"{node.hostname}:{node.port}"])
await self.daemon.jsonrpc_wallet_reconnect()
features = await self.ledger.network.get_server_features()
self.assertEqual(features["payment_address"], address)
self.assertEqual(features["daily_fee"], "1.0")
await asyncio.wait_for(self.on_address_update(address), timeout=1)
_, history = await self.ledger.get_local_status_and_history(address)
txid, nout = history[0]
tx_details = await self.daemon.jsonrpc_transaction_show(txid)
self.assertEqual(tx_details.outputs[nout].amount, 100000000)
self.assertEqual(tx_details.outputs[nout].get_address(self.ledger), address)
